Lice are not unusual among adults, but they spread more easily among children as children spend more time together at school and on playgrounds.

Having head lice is not fatal or particularly dangerous, but it is nevertheless a somewhat unpleasant experience that can be very itchy and discomfortable. Another important reason to get rid of them is that they multiply very quickly.
